@ -262,6 +262,12 @@ The buffer size of the ``ClusterSingletonProxy`` can be defined in the ``Cluster
|
|||
instead of defining ``stash-capacity`` of the mailbox. Buffering can be disabled by using a
|
||||
buffer size of 0.
|
||||
|
||||
The ``singletonPath`` parameter of ``ClusterSingletonProxy.props`` has changed. It is now named
|
||||
``singletonManagerPath`` and is the logical path of the singleton manager, e.g. ``/user/singletonManager``,
|
||||
which ends with the name you defined in ``actorOf`` when creating the ``ClusterSingletonManager``.
|
||||
In 2.3.x it was the path to singleton instance, which was error-prone because one had to provide both
|
||||
the name of the singleton manager and the singleton actor.
